You sound like me. I was shocked and really uncomfortable, not just with my hair loss but with how much my hair loss bothered me. I never believed so much of my confidence was tied up in such a superficial trait.

I started using minoxidil (rogaine) and finasteride, a once a day pill, and started to get my hair back. I get the rogaine brand from Costco, $50 for a 6 month supply, and the finasteride from my dermatologist, which is even more affordable, but you could use Hims or Keeps or one of the subscriptions as well. Same products. I did a ton of personal research before starting because I always got the impression the industry is full of scams, but those two products used together successfully treat approx. 90 percent of men. It is important to note however that a doctor will define successful treatment as stopping hairloss, not starting regrowth.

Red-light therapy is also a thing that has worked and shows some efficacy but the academic sources were harder to come by and has a higher start up cost.
